• OpenAI Gym安装和使用详解

    使用 OpenAI Gym 作为实践环境,这是一个可以用来研究和比较强化学习算法的开源工具包,包含了各种可用来训练和研究新的强化学习算法的模拟环境。

    OpenAI Gym的安装

    首先需要安装 OpenAI Gym,最简洁的方法是使用 pip install gym

    OpenAI Gym 提供了多种环境,比如 Atari、棋盘游戏以及 2D 或 3D 游戏引擎等。在 Windows 上的最小安装只支持算法基本环境,如 toy_text 和 classic_control 这几种。

    如果你想研究其他环境,需要安装更多依赖项,如 OS X 和 Ubuntu 系统支持完整版本。

    详细的说明可以在 OpenAI Gym 的 GitHub 链接(https://github.com/openai/gym#installing-dependencies-for-specific-environments)中阅读。

    OpenAI Gym的使用

    1. OpenAI Gym 提供了一个统一的环境接口,智能体可以通过三种基本方法:重置、执行和回馈与环境交互:

      • 重置操作会重置环境并返回观测值;
      • 执行操作会在环境中执行一个时间步长,并返回观测值、奖励、状态和信息;
      • 回馈操作会回馈环境的一个帧,比如弹出交互窗口。
    2. 使用 OpenAI Gym 首先需要将其载入:



       

更多...

加载中...